Comparative Study Between Intravenous Iron Sucrose and Oral Iron for Treatment of Post Partum Anemia

Abstract: AIMS & OBJECTIVES:The aim of study was to compare the efficacy, safety and compliance of intravenous iron sucrose complex with oral Iron therapy in treatment of postpartum anemia. MATERIAL AND METHODS: 60 postpartum women who had delivered within 24 -48 hours and having hemoglobin <9.0 gm./dl and serum ferritin < 15 μg/L were studied prospectively.
